Do you have to take five subjects in 10+2 to apply for KEAM or is it necessary that the candidate takes English , Maths,Physics andChemistr

Saakshi Lama 12th Dec, 2018

Hello,

As per the previous year's notification for KEAM, the candidates need to have passed Higher Secondary Examination, Kerala or equivalent examination with 50% marks in Mathematics separately and 50% marks in Mathematics, Physics and Chemistry put together. Read KEAM Eligibility Criteria

What are the modern professional courses that can be applied by a bsc physics student?

Dr Atul Sharma 9th Dec, 2018

Dear Sandra,

  • First of all, you understand the career options available to you as a physics major. Common job titles for physics and engineering physics bachelor's degree recipients include:Accelerator Operator
  • Applications Engineer
  • Data Analyst
  • Design Engineer
  • High School Physics Teacher
  • IT Consultant
  • Lab Technician
  • Laser Engineer
  • Optical Engineer
  • Research Associate
